Characteristics of baby tissues
To equip a baby bed, you should select high-quality materials. They must meet basic requirements.
- Be safe for the baby . Bedding should not emit harmful substances that can lead to dermatitis, allergic rashes, itching and other problems. In the manufacture of such materials, no chemically "aggressive" dyes should be used.
- Be hygroscopic . Children often sweat during nighttime or daytime sleep, so the bed fabric should absorb excess moisture well and dry quickly.
- It is good to allow air to pass through . Natural circulation will allow the skin to "breathe", thus creating favorable conditions for a quality rest.
- Contribute to the absence of static accumulation .
- Differ in color fastness . Sometimes it happens that patterns with a colorful and vibrant fabric remain on the baby's skin after sleep. It shouldn't be like that.
- Be comfortable . The bedding material should create a pleasant tactile sensation when in contact with the body.
- Have sufficient strength and durability . The fact is that bed linen in a crib gets dirty much more often than in an adult. Therefore, it is important that the material can withstand more than a dozen washings while maintaining its original qualities.
- Ease of care . This is an optional criterion. However, any parent will appreciate if the fabric is easy to clean, dry quickly and smoothed out with little effort.
An important selection criterion is the appearance of the fabric. Before falling asleep, many children look at drawings on a duvet cover, pillowcase, or sheet. Therefore, images on bedding should be unobtrusive, but attractive to babies.
Types of fabrics
For sewing bedding, fabrics made from natural fibers are best suited. They meet most of the requirements for the quality of children's underwear. Let's consider the features, advantages and disadvantages of some of them.
Chintz
This is a thin cotton fabric that does not contain artificial fibers. Its advantages include absolute safety for the health of the baby, lightness and affordable cost. The disadvantage of chintz is its poor durability, which is why this material is able to "lose" its appearance after several washes.
Satin
A dense material with a silky texture. It does not "shrink" when washing and practically does not wrinkle. In addition, its advantages include high wear resistance and excellent aesthetic qualities.
However, this material is preferred by few because of its high cost.
Calico
Such fabric perfectly absorbs excess moisture, promotes natural air circulation, "cools" the skin in the heat of summer and warms up in coolness. Beautiful bedding is made from this fabric. A wide variety of shades and patterns allows you to choose a material for every taste. However, this fabric also has disadvantages.
The disadvantages include its rigidity and low density, due to which the linen can quickly "fail".
Flannel
This is one of the most pleasant to the touch fabrics. It is soft, hygroscopic, safe and durable. This warm material will not cause allergic rashes in the child and will contribute to a comfortable and healthy sleep. The disadvantages of this material are insignificant. These include shrinkage, long drying and abrasion of the pile during operation.
Cotton
This is a material that is highly hygroscopic, financially affordable, and practical. It is lightweight and pleasant to the touch. The disadvantages of this fabric include the possibility of shrinkage, rapid fading when exposed to sunlight, creasing.
Such material will not last long.
Linen
Natural material with the best hygienic qualities. It quickly absorbs the resulting moisture and helps maintain optimal temperature conditions. In addition, flax has bactericidal properties. The material prevents the development and active reproduction of bed mites and other microorganisms. Has such a fabric and disadvantages. These include excessive rigidity and a high price.
Due to these features, flax is not suitable for babies.
Bamboo
Natural material based on bamboo fibers has been gaining popularity lately. Bedding is made from it for both babies and older children. Bamboo is famous for its antimicrobial properties, hygroscopicity and hypoallergenic properties. Bedding sets made of this fabric are suitable for babies with sensitive and delicate skin. The significant disadvantages of bamboo include its high cost.
Some manufacturing companies make bedding for children from blended fabrics . Such materials are obtained by "mixing" natural fibers with synthetic ones. The result is beautiful-looking fabrics that do not "shrink" during washing, practically do not wrinkle, are easy to wash and are durable. However, these fabrics are poorly hygienic. They also build up static electricity, making your baby's sleep uncomfortable.
The best fabrics for a baby bed are completely natural. Among the wide variety of such materials, linen, cotton and bamboo are considered the best.
If parents want to provide the highest quality and comfortable rest for their child, they should choose bed linen from these natural fabrics.
Colors
When choosing a set of bedding or fabric for a duvet cover, pillowcase or sheet, you should consider its color. Scientists have long proven that colors can influence the psyche of a child, his mood and behavior.
When buying fabric for a baby's crib, it is better to choose products in delicate pastel colors . White and milky shades will help calm and relax the baby, ensuring that he or she quickly falls to bed. Also, pale blue, pale pink and beige tones of bed linen will "help you fall asleep". It is important to take into account that the accessories should not have numerous bright images. It is better that the number of pictures is limited, and their tones are light.
Bright colors such as green, red, orange, blue can energize children and give them energy. Due to these features, bed linen with such shades is recommended to be used for the beds of babies who are already beginning to show interest in games.
When choosing fabric for a baby sleeping set, you should refuse to purchase materials in dark colors. Blue, black, purple, dark brown colors will make the child feel anxious.
Bed linen of such colors will not allow the baby to relax and fall asleep quickly.
Recommendations
To choose the best fabric for your duvet cover, pillowcase and sheet, there are a number of important points to consider.
- The material should be smooth to the touch. The uneven texture formed by the appliqués and inserts can be unpleasant when it comes into contact with the delicate skin of a child.
- An unobtrusive textile aroma should blow from the fabric. If it smells harsh, you need to refuse to purchase it. In this case, there is a great risk of buying material, in the production of which low-quality dyes were used.
- Before purchasing a fabric, you should ask the seller to provide accompanying documentation, for example, a quality certificate. In the absence of papers, it is better to buy the material in another store.
- It is best to purchase fabrics for bedding at large retail outlets specializing in the sale of children's textiles.
- Polish, Turkish and Russian materials are considered to be among the best in terms of quality and cost ratio.
Observing all the above recommendations, you can easily purchase high-quality and beautiful fabric for a stylish baby bedding set.
